Introduction

This chapter will cover chart creation in Tableau Desktop. The first section will include the different types of charts available and how to create them. How to conduct spatial analysis with geographic charts will then be covered, followed by the advanced analytical capabilities available in Tableau when building a chart.

The primary function of Tableau is to help analyze data and, to do this, charts can be built to visualize the data. Decisions can be made with the insights provided.
